Starlink is a satellite internet constellation constructed by SpaceX providing a low latency, broadband internet system to meet the needs of consumers across the globe.

Will Starlink compensate me for the outage?

The recent Starlink outages have enraged many of the company's customers. These nationwide outages have prevented many customers from accessing their services.

It is crucial to get in touch with Starlink if you are a client and have encountered an outage in order to report the problem and receive assistance. For updates on known outages in your area, visit their website. For the inconvenience, Starlink has occasionally given some customers credits and other forms of payment.
